Immerse yourself in the captivating world of Camille Saint-Saëns with this remarkable album, "Saint-Saëns: Symphony No. 1, Concertos," released on June 18, 2012, under the esteemed Onyx Classics label. This classical masterpiece spans a duration of one hour and four minutes, offering a rich and diverse listening experience.
The album features a stunning array of compositions, including the enchanting "La Muse et le Poète, Op. 132," and the Cello Concerto No. 1 in E-flat Major, Op. 33, with its three distinct movements: "I. Allegro non troppo," "II. Allegretto con moto," and "III. Tempo primo." Additionally, the Symphony No. 1 in E-flat, Op. 2, is presented in its entirety, showcasing four captivating movements: "I. Adagio - Allegro," "II. Marche - Scherzo. Allegro scherzando," "III. Adagio," and "IV. Finale. Allegro maestoso."
Saint-Saëns, a prolific French composer, pianist, organist, and conductor, is celebrated for his unique blend of Romantic and Classical styles.
